Hi,

does anyone own a motherboard with an intel chipset and with an ICH5/6
io controller hub? I've modified atapi a little bit. Atapi may detect
the second ide (SATA) controller of an ICH5/6. I'm interested on the
debug output from atapi while booting.

- Hartmut
